The Armed Forces Covenant Fund Trust is holding a free virtual webinar on Monday, June 26th 2023 at 10.00 am on Exploring peer support, safe spaces and essential collaboration at the heart of the Veterans’ Places, Pathways and People programme.
The webinar will focus on the progress of the Veterans' Places, Pathways and People programme (VPPP). This programme aims to give ex-Service personnel safe and welcoming places to go in their local area , support them in accessing mental health support and treatment pathways , and ensure that the staff and volunteers can access good quality training.
The two-hour session will feature an introduction from Chief Executive Anna Wright, a talk on the background and latest outcomes of the VPPP programme after its first year, and a Q&A with panellists. Attendees will also have a chance to hear from some of the funded projects and organisations involved.
